A signed integer overflow in docopt.cpp v0.6.2 (LeafPattern::match in docopt_private.h) when merging occurrence counters (e.g., default LONG_MAX + first user "-v/--verbose") can cause counter wrap (negative/unbounded semantics) and lead to logic/policy bypass in applications that rely on occurrence-based limits, rate-gating, or safety toggles. In hardened builds (e.g., UBSan or -ftrapv), the overflow may also result in process abort (DoS).
